The Sherp N 1200 is a true beast of an all-terrain vehicle, designed to tackle the most extreme conditions with ease. It's the latest addition to the Sherp family, known for their unstoppable prowess in traversing mud, snow, water, and even ice. With its massive tires, rugged construction, and powerful engine, the N 1200 is ready to take you anywhere – no matter how challenging the journey.

Specifications that Impress:

  • Engine: Doosan D18 1.8-liter, 3-cylinder diesel engine, churning out 55 horsepower and 190 Nm of torque – enough to propel this behemoth through almost anything. It powering the N 1200, has a typical operating temperature range of -30°C to +40°C (-22°F to 104°F). This suggests the engine itself should function in these temperatures.

  • Transmission: A reliable 6-speed manual Renault gearbox that puts the power to the ground effectively.

  • Dimensions: Standing tall at 3984mm, 2570mm wide, and 2846mm high, the N 1200 is a force to be reckoned with on any terrain.

  • Tires: The secret to its unstoppable nature lies in its massive 1800x600x25 tubeless, extra-low pressure tires that provide unmatched grip and flotation.

  • Suspension: A unique pneumatic circulating suspension system that keeps the wheels in contact with the ground no matter how uneven the terrain.

  • Speed: While not built for speed, the N 1200 can reach a respectable 40 km/h on flat ground, and navigate obstacles at a crawling pace of 2 km/h.

  • Fuel Capacity: An impressive 95-liter main tank, complemented by four 58-liter fuel canisters, grants the N 1200 a staggering 232-liter fuel capacity, translating to a 61-hour range – perfect for long expeditions.

  • Load Capacity: Haul all your gear and supplies with a 1200 kg payload capacity, expandable to 2100 kg with an additional cargo trailer.

  • Passenger Capacity: Comfortably accommodate up to 9 people (including the driver) in the spacious cabin.

  • Towing Capacity: Need to bring even more? The N 1200 can tow up to 2350 kg, making it a versatile workhorse for various tasks.

Beyond the Numbers:

The Sherp N 1200 is more than just a set of impressive specifications. It's a vehicle designed for those who crave adventure and push the boundaries of what's possible. Here are some additional features that make the N 1200 truly special:

  • Integrated front and rear footboards: Providing easy access to the cabin and a convenient platform for surveying the terrain.

  • Hardtop: Offering shelter from the elements and additional cargo space.

  • Steel frame and bottom, hot-dip galvanized: Ensuring durability and corrosion resistance to withstand the harshest environments.

  • Aluminum cabin: Combining strength with weight savings for optimal performance.

  • Skid steering: Allowing for tight maneuvering and unparalleled control in challenging situations.

  • Closed oil bath chains for lubrication: Keeping the drivetrain running smoothly even in the most demanding conditions.

  • Increased cabin volume by 30%: Providing ample space and comfort for passengers and gear.

  • Eco-friendly engine: Meeting Stage 5 / Tier-4-final emission standards, making the N 1200 a responsible choice for adventure enthusiasts.
